How to Set Up Wingspan in Under 5 Minutes

Organize your bird cards, food tokens, and player mats for lightning-fast setup.

Wingspan has a lot of components — bird cards, food tokens, eggs, player mats, a dice tower birdfeeder, bonus cards, round goals. Setup can drag if you're not organized.

The 6-Step Setup Speedrun

1

Player Mats + Action Cubes

30 sec
Each player takes a mat and 8 action cubes. If using Oceania mats (recommended), use the teal side for the standard game.
2

Birdfeeder + Food Dice

15 sec
Place the dice tower in the center. Roll all 5 food dice into it. Done — the birdfeeder is ready.
3

Bird Card Tray

45 sec
Shuffle the bird deck. Place it face-down. Flip 3 cards face-up into the tray. If you store the deck pre-shuffled (do this at teardown), this is 15 seconds.
4

Eggs + Food Tokens

30 sec
Place the egg supply in a central bowl. Set out food tokens by type. Using 3D-printed food tokens instead of the cardboard dice makes this instant — they're pre-sorted by shape.
5

Round Goals + Bonus Cards

45 sec
Place the 4 round goal tiles on the goal board (random or predetermined). Deal 2 bonus cards to each player — they'll keep one.
6

Starting Hand

60 sec
Deal 5 bird cards to each player. Each player also gets 5 food tokens (1 of each type). Players simultaneously choose which birds and food to keep — total birds + food must equal 5.

Storage Tips for Instant Setup

🎲

Keep the 5 food dice in the birdfeeder tower between games — just roll on setup

🥚

Store eggs in a single ziplock — they're all identical, no sorting needed

🃏

Shuffle the bird deck at teardown, not at setup (less annoying when you're eager to play)

📦

Use the original insert or an organizer — Wingspan's box is well-designed for component separation
